Effective Python Skill
Apply the 90 items from Brett Slatkin's "Effective Python" (2nd Edition) to review existing code and write new Python code. This skill operates in two modes: Review Mode (analyze code for violations) and Write Mode (produce idiomatic Python from scratch).
Reference Files
This skill includes categorized reference files with all 90 items:
ref-01-pythonic-thinking.md— Items 1-10: PEP 8, f-strings, bytes/str, walrus operator, unpacking, enumerate, zip, slicingref-02-lists-and-dicts.md— Items 11-18: Slicing, sorting, dict ordering, defaultdict, missingref-03-functions.md— Items 19-26: Exceptions vs None, closures, *args/**kwargs, keyword-only args, decoratorsref-04-comprehensions-generators.md— Items 27-36: Comprehensions, generators, yield from, itertoolsref-05-classes-interfaces.md— Items 37-43: Composition, @classmethod, super(), mix-ins, public attrsref-06-metaclasses-attributes.md— Items 44-51: @property, descriptors, getattr, init_subclass, class decoratorsref-07-concurrency.md— Items 52-64: subprocess, threads, Lock, Queue, coroutines, asyncioref-08-robustness-performance.md— Items 65-76: try/except, contextlib, datetime, decimal, profiling, data structuresref-09-testing-debugging.md— Items 77-85: TestCase, mocks, dependency injection, pdb, tracemallocref-10-collaboration.md— Items 86-90: Docstrings, packages, root exceptions, virtual environments
